Introduction

Blush is an essential makeup item that can transform your look by adding a natural flush of color to your cheeks. Whether you prefer a subtle hint of color or a bold statement, blush comes in various formulations, including powder, cream, and liquid, allowing you to choose the best type for your skin and makeup style. When applied correctly, blush can create the illusion of higher cheekbones and a youthful glow, making it a staple in many beauty routines.

Here are some key points to consider when selecting and applying blush:
  • Choose the Right Shade: Opt for shades that complement your skin tone. For fair skin, soft pinks and peaches work well, while deeper skin tones can pull off richer colors like berry or plum.
  • Application Techniques: Use a brush for powder blush and your fingers or a sponge for cream or liquid formulas. Apply blush to the apples of your cheeks and blend upwards towards your temples for a natural look.
  • Layering: Start with a small amount of product and build up to your desired intensity. This prevents over-application and ensures a more natural finish.
  • Long-lasting Wear: For extended wear, consider setting your blush with a translucent powder or using a primer beforehand.
Blush is not just about color; it’s about enhancing your features and boosting your confidence. With the right application and shade, you can achieve a radiant and healthy look that is sure to turn heads. Remember, blush is a personal choice, and experimenting with different shades and techniques can help you discover what works best for you.

FAQs

To choose the best blush, consider your skin tone, the finish you prefer (matte or shimmer), and the formulation that suits your skin type (powder, cream, or liquid).

Look for pigmentation, blendability, and long-lasting wear. It’s also important to select a shade that complements your natural complexion.

Common mistakes include applying too much product, choosing the wrong shade, or not blending well. Start with a light hand and build up the color gradually.

To make blush last longer, apply a primer beforehand, use a setting powder on top, or try a long-wear formulation.

Yes! Blush can also be used on the eyelids for a cohesive look or on the lips for a monochromatic effect, as long as the formulation is suitable for those areas.
